26/P/0836/TRCA - Works to trees - Conservation Area Approved

Proposal

T1: Beech with Ganoderma brackets at base - Remove to ground level (as recommended in attached Arboricultural Consultant report). T2: Beech - Reduction of 2m in height, 2m in lateral spread to south, and 1.5m in lateral spread to west and northwest (as recommended in attached Arboricultural Consultant report). T3: Yew - Canopy lift to 4m. T4: Yew - Canopy lift to 3m. T5: Portuguese Laurel - Remove to ground level, to be replanted with native tree. Site constraints 4

Lower Langford conservation area
Demolition needs planning permission and permitted development is restricted.
The council must give weight to preserving or enhancing the area's character and appearance. Not every council has published its boundaries as open data.
Habitat network: Network Enhancement Zone 1
Where habitat is joined up enough to work as a network. Context, not a constraint on its own.
